package org.mapfish.print.processor.http; import org.springframework.http.HttpMethod; import org.springframework.http.client.ClientHttpRequest; import org.springframework.test.context.ContextConfiguration; import java.io.IOException; import java.net.URI; import java.net.URISyntaxException; import javax.annotation.Nullable; import static org.junit.Assert.assertEquals; @ContextConfiguration(locations = { "classpath:org/mapfish/print/processor/http/use-http-for-https/add-custom-processor-application-context.xml" }) public class UseHttpForHttpsProcessorTest extends AbstractHttpProcessorTest { @Override protected String baseDir() { return "use-http-for-https"; } @Override protected Class<TestProcessor> testProcessorClass() { return TestProcessor.class; } @Override protected Class<? extends AbstractClientHttpRequestFactoryProcessor> classUnderTest() { return UseHttpForHttpsProcessor.class; } public static class TestProcessor extends AbstractTestProcessor { String userinfo = "user:pass"; String host = "localhost"; String path = "path"; String query = "query"; String fragment = "fragment"; @Nullable @Override public Void execute(TestParam values, ExecutionContext context) throws Exception { testDefinedPortMapping(values); testImplicitPortMapping(values); testUriWithOnlyAuthoritySegment(values); testHttp(values); return null; } private void testUriWithOnlyAuthoritySegment(TestParam values) throws URISyntaxException, IOException { String authHost = "center_wmts_fixedscale.com"; URI uri = new URI("https://" + userinfo + "@" + authHost + ":8443/" + path); ClientHttpRequest request = values.clientHttpRequestFactoryProvider.get().createRequest(uri, HttpMethod.GET); assertEquals("http", request.getURI().getScheme()); assertEquals(userinfo + "@" + authHost + ":9999", request.getURI().getAuthority()); assertEquals("/" + path, request.getURI().getPath()); uri = new URI("https://" + authHost + ":8443/" + path); request = values.clientHttpRequestFactoryProvider.get().createRequest(uri, HttpMethod.GET); assertEquals("http", request.getURI().getScheme()); assertEquals(authHost + ":9999", request.getURI().getAuthority()); uri = new URI("https://" + authHost + "/" + path); request = values.clientHttpRequestFactoryProvider.get().createRequest(uri, HttpMethod.GET); assertEquals("http", request.getURI().getScheme()); assertEquals(authHost, request.getURI().getAuthority()); uri = new URI("https://" + userinfo + "@" + authHost + "/" + path); request = values.clientHttpRequestFactoryProvider.get().createRequest(uri, HttpMethod.GET); assertEquals("http", request.getURI().getScheme()); assertEquals(userinfo + "@" + authHost, request.getURI().getAuthority()); } private void testHttp(TestParam values) throws URISyntaxException, IOException { String uriString = String.format("http://%s@%s:9999/%s?%s#%s", userinfo, host, path, query, fragment); final ClientHttpRequest request = values.clientHttpRequestFactoryProvider.get().createRequest(new URI(uriString), HttpMethod.GET); assertEquals("http", request.getURI().getScheme()); assertEquals(userinfo, request.getURI().getUserInfo()); assertEquals(host, request.getURI().getHost()); assertEquals(9999, request.getURI().getPort()); assertEquals("/" + path, request.getURI().getPath()); assertEquals(query, request.getURI().getQuery()); assertEquals(fragment, request.getURI().getFragment()); } private void testDefinedPortMapping(TestParam values) throws IOException, URISyntaxException { String uriString = String.format("https://%s@%s:8443/%s?%s#%s", userinfo, host, path, query, fragment); final ClientHttpRequest request = values.clientHttpRequestFactoryProvider.get().createRequest(new URI(uriString), HttpMethod.GET); assertEquals("http", request.getURI().getScheme()); assertEquals(userinfo, request.getURI().getUserInfo()); assertEquals(host, request.getURI().getHost()); assertEquals(9999, request.getURI().getPort()); assertEquals("/" + path, request.getURI().getPath()); assertEquals(query, request.getURI().getQuery()); assertEquals(fragment, request.getURI().getFragment()); } private void testImplicitPortMapping(TestParam values) throws IOException, URISyntaxException { String uriString = String.format("https://%s@%s/%s?%s#%s", userinfo, host, path, query, fragment); final ClientHttpRequest request = values.clientHttpRequestFactoryProvider.get().createRequest(new URI(uriString), HttpMethod.GET); assertEquals("http", request.getURI().getScheme()); assertEquals(userinfo, request.getURI().getUserInfo()); assertEquals(host, request.getURI().getHost()); assertEquals(-1, request.getURI().getPort()); assertEquals("/" + path, request.getURI().getPath()); assertEquals(query, request.getURI().getQuery()); assertEquals(fragment, request.getURI().getFragment()); } } }
